have a query regarding exemption of Disability Pension received from Indian Armed forces.
I want to know under which section this exemption will be allowed??
As per instruction no 2/2001 F No 200/51/99 ITA.I is exempt |

Section 10 (18) of the Income Tax Act is reproduced below :
Section 10
INCOMES NOT INCLUDED IN TOTAL INCOME.
In computing the total income of a previous year of any person, any income falling within any of the following clauses shall not be included :
10 (18) : Any income by way of - (i) Pension received by an individual who has been in the service of the Central or State Government and has been awarded "Param Vir Chakra" or "Maha Vir Chakra" or "Vir Chakra" or such other gallantry award as the Central Government may, by notification in the Official Gazette, specify in this behalf;
(ii) Family pension received by any member of the family of an individual referred to in sub-clause (i)
